One thing I've noticed on several of the videos is at the end of the A part
most are playing a double stop 4th finger A/open A and slurring
in/tremoloing in a first finger B note. I'm pretty certain that should be a
second finger C natural. Anyone else looking at that?

I don't know if this'll help the effort, but as Don pointed out to me
in a sidebar discussion, the Hatcher version, and the reference video
of the two women playing fiddle, plays the B part one and a half
times. In the middle of the second time through, Hatcher has kind of a
brain bubble, drags out
